Output 959a3a914b8647bf78dc6df6556468e1c44d680f3b17edbc07bc32d140f35d75:2

value
57683
script pubkey
OP_0 OP_PUSHBYTES_20 96a5efdc382db12ed54b81afc41233856524a23e
address
bc1qj6j7lhpc9kcja42tsxhugy3ns4jjfg37njk639
transaction
959a3a914b8647bf78dc6df6556468e1c44d680f3b17edbc07bc32d140f35d75
confirmations
202346
spent
true